问:32位架构处理器是指的什么?
答:32位架构处理器是指一种计算机处理器,其寻址和数据总线的宽度为32位。这意味着该处理器能够同时处理32位(4字节)大小的数据。在这种架构下,处理器的寻址能力限制在32位的地址空间内,最大可寻址的内存为4GB(2的32次方字节)。
32位处理器最早出现于上世纪80年代,并在很长一段时间内是计算机系统中最常见的架构之一。它们被广泛用于个人计算机、服务器、嵌入式系统和移动设备等各种应用中。
与32位处理器相对的是64位处理器,其寻址和数据总线的宽度为64位,提供更大的内存寻址空间和更高的计算性能。64位处理器已逐渐取代32位处理器成为主流架构,特别是在高性能计算和服务器领域。然而,许多现代操作系统和应用程序仍然支持32位处理器,以保持与旧硬件和软件的兼容性。
问:BSD算法是什么算法?
答:有两种不同的算法,称为 BSD。一种是校验和算法,另一种是比较系统发育树的方法。
**BSD 校验和算法**
BSD 校验和算法是旧版 BSD 操作系统中常用的传统校验和算法。也可以通过“sum”命令行实用程序使用它。该算法的工作原理是将数据分成 8 位的段,然后将每个段添加到累加器中,累加器在每次求和之间循环右移。为了将累加器保持在返回值范围内,使用 1 进行位屏蔽。最终的校验和是累加器除以 255 的余数。
BSD 校验和算法不是很安全,并且它比 CRC-32 校验和算法的错误检测能力更弱。不再建议在新应用中使用它。
**用于比较系统发育树的 BSD 方法**
BSD方法是一种比较系统发育树的方法。它由 Philippe Lecompte 及其同事于 2004 年首次推出。该方法的工作原理是计算两棵树之间公共二分的数量。二分区是将树的叶节点划分为两个非空集合。两棵树之间的BSD是两棵树之间公共二分的数量之和。
BSD 方法已被证明是比较系统发育树的有用工具。它对于比较关系不密切的树特别有用。BSD 方法已用于多种应用,包括进化研究、基因鉴定以及系统发育数据库的开发。
问:为什么芯片在运行过程都怕热?
答:芯片在运行过程中会产生热量的原因是因为其内部的电流流动和电子元件之间的电阻会导致能量损耗。这些能量损耗会转化为热能,并导致芯片温度上升。
芯片的正常运行需要保持适当的温度范围。如果温度过高,可能会导致以下问题:
1. 降低可靠性:高温会使芯片内部的电子元件受到损坏或热膨胀,可能导致设备故障或性能下降。
2. 热脆化:一些材料在高温下会变得脆弱,容易发生损坏或断裂。
3. 电气特性变差:温度升高会导致电子元件的电阻、电容和电感等参数发生变化,可能导致电路的性能下降或不可预测的行为。
4. 功耗增加:高温下,芯片的电子元件会产生更多的漏电流,从而导致额外的功耗,影响电子设备的能效。
因此,为了确保芯片的正常运行和可靠性,需要进行散热处理。这可以通过散热器、风扇、热管、散热胶等散热装置来有效地将芯片产生的热量传导和散发到周围环境中,以保持芯片温度在可接受范围内。
领取专属 10元无门槛券
私享最新 技术干货